‘Agni Natchathiram’ to be remade in Tamil – Telugu!
If industry insiders are to be believed, Mani Ratnam’s cult blockbuster ‘Agni Natchathiram’ will be remade in Tamil and Telugu by producer T Ramesh.
“Agni Natchathiram is a cult classic and I’m thoroughly thrilled to remake it as a bilingual in Tamil – Telugu. I’m in talks with the big stars of Tamil and Telugu film industries for this remake and I can assure that it will be a big project with a big star from both the industries in the lead”, says T Ramesh.
T Ramesh is the producer of Vishal – Trisha starrer ‘Samar’. An announcement listing the cast and crew of the film is expected from him shortly. Buzz is that a couple of supporting actors from the original might be retained in the remake as well.
The film is about two half brothers, played by Prabhu and Karthik in the original. It was dubbed in Telugu back then and was also remade in Hindi. It will be interesting to watch who will be cast as the brothers in the remake.
Ajith-Vishnuvarthan multi-starrer to get Tollywood actors!!!
The list of actors being roped in for Ajith’s next with Vishnuvardhan seems to be never-ending! While Nayanthara, Arya and Taapsee have been signed on to play the lead roles in this multi-starrer, we can tell you that two other prominent actors will also be added to the cast.
While it’s almost confirmed that Arvind Swamy will play an important character in the film, talks are on with some of the prominent Telugu actors, including Ravi Teja and Nagarjuna, for a powerful guest role.
A source in the know says, “Vishnuvardhan and his team are in talks with several leading actors for a guest role. They’ve spoken with Nagarjuna (who was supposed to work with Ajith earlier in Mankatha), Ravi Teja and Jagapathi Babu as of now. Prithviraj is also on the list. There’s a good chance the film will be released in Telugu as well, and it only makes sense to rope in another actor who is equally popular in Tollywood. However, the unit is in no hurry to finalise the actor now because the guest appearance portion will be shot much later.”
When contacted, producer A M Rathnam refused to divulge details, but added, “We’re working out the modalities, and an official announcement will be made in a couple of days.”
